WebApr 7, 2024 · These practices can keep you on track to defend against cyber threats: 1. Keep software current. Most of the time legacy software no longer receives security updates, leaving your applications and operating systems vulnerable. Keeping software up to date gives you a fighting chance against an attack. 2. WebA password management application can help you to keep your passwords locked down. 3. Keep your software updated. This is especially important with your operating systems and internet security software. Cybercriminals frequently use known exploits, or flaws, in your software to gain access to your system.
